Loudoun County, VA- The Loudoun County Sheriff’s Office is investigating a reported indecent exposure in the Brambleton area on Wednesday and are working to determine if it is connected to a similar case reported last spring.
On October 10, the victim reported she was walking in the south parking garage of the Brambleton Town Center when around 5 p.m. she observed an unclothed male standing in the stairwell. The suspect was observed simulating a sexual act. The suspect was described as a white male with dark brown hair and dark brown facial hair. He was further described as being of medium build and height.

The victim had no contact with the suspect. The area was searched and the suspect was not located.
Detectives with the Loudoun County Sheriff’s Office believe this case is possibly connected to a similar incident that occurred in the same area back on April 8. In that case, a teenaged victim was in the north parking garage of the Brambleton Town Center around 6:30 p.m. when she observed an unknown male who was unclothed behind her car. The suspect appeared to be performing a sexual act. The victim drove away and had no contact with the suspect.
During the April 8 investigation a composite sketch of the suspect was developed and released to the public.
Anyone with any information regarding his possible identity is asked to contact Detective S. Smith with the Loudoun County Sheriff’s Office Special Victims Unit at 703-777-1021.
